Latrine Picture Taken by Dan Reynolds

Latrine picture
This picture shows part of bank of toilet seats in public bathroom serving both the Roman Arena and the Roman theatre in Merida (Augustus Emeritus), Spain. This city was known as a retirement community for Roman military in Spain (it was the city from which Gladiator’s Maximus supposedly hailed). Toilets were against wall, base of which is visible. This area of ruins was full of water channels for fresh and sewer water.
